This is a memoir of the early months of World War I by General John French, commander of the British Expeditionary Force in France. French provides a first-hand account of the chaotic early stages of the war, when the outcome was far from certain and the horrors of modern warfare were just beginning to be revealed. This is a gripping and often harrowing read for anyone interested in the history of war.
